ecowen Posted November 18, 2004 #2 Share Posted November 18, 2004 It's a fabulous cabin! It's a few feet wider than other 1A's, with a lovely teak wood balcony that is 3 times deeper. It's a great location, nestled in with the suites, where it is quiet and the service the best on the ship. Grab it!:D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

ecowen Posted November 18, 2004 #4 Share Posted November 18, 2004 In fact, you'll be treated BETTER, since the butler will be hanging around your cabin all day. You might even be able to slip him some $$$ and get suite services (ie, afternoon snacks and pre-dinner appetizers).:p Regarding the ajoining cabin. . .it wouldn't bother me. The only drawback is that you don't get a loveseat couch (it would block the door) and there is a slightly higher risk of noise. So bring earplugs if you're worried about that, and enjoy a grate cabin!:)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
